Huawei has officially launched the WATCH FIT 5 series, adding a new set of smartwatches to its lineup. The announcement came during the Pura series event, and as expected, the focus is on a mix of design, fitness features, and battery life rather than anything too experimental.

The WATCH FIT 5 Pro comes with a 1.92-inch LTPO AMOLED display with a resolution of 480 × 408. It’s surrounded by fairly slim 1.8mm bezels and protected with a 2.5D glass, which gives the watch a modern look overall. The display reaches up to 3000 nits, so visibility outdoors shouldn’t be much of a problem.
Just like last year’s WATCH Fit 4 Pro, the successor uses a titanium alloy bezel, and Huawei is pairing it with a woven strap that’s meant to feel lighter and more comfortable. Without the strap, the watch weighs 30.4 grams. Color options include White, Orange, and Black.
On the feature side, Huawei is leaning into shorter, more casual workouts. There are additions like “cycling assistant” and a golf mode. Health tracking includes ECG support and some form of blood sugar monitoring research, though how that works in practice will matter more than the feature list itself.
The list of sensors includes:
- Accelerometer
- Gyroscope sensor
- Geomagnetic sensor
- Ambient light sensor
- Optical heart rate sensor
- barometric pressure sensor
- Temperature sensor
- ECG sensor
- Depth sensor
Battery life is fairly typical for this category. Huawei says the WATCH FIT 5 Pro can last up to 7 days of regular use, or around 10 days if you’re not pushing it too hard.

The standard WATCH FIT 5 gets a slightly smaller 1.82-inch AMOLED display, though it keeps the same resolution as the Pro and reaches up to 2500 nits brightness. It also includes most of the same sensors, just without ECG and the depth sensor. It comes in purple, green, white, and black, and is aimed at users who want a lighter watch at 27g, versus 30.4g for the Pro, without all the extra features.
Pricing and availability:
Pricing starts at 1099 yuan for the WATCH FIT 5 and 2099 yuan for the Pro. The standard model went up for pre-order on April 20 and goes on sale April 29, while the Pro opens for pre-orders on April 29 and will be available from May 15.
